We present a framework based on temporal asymmetry as a measure of non-equilibrium. WebFoci of cellular alteration may be classified as eosinophilic, basophilic, vacuolated, clear cell, or mixed. They may progress to adenomas and occasionally to carcinomas (Ward, 1984b; Frith et al., 1980a). The cells in the eosinophilic foci can be either the same size or more often larger than adjacent normal hepatocytes.
